Summary:
Assists in the interpretation, communication, tracking and implementation of CMS (Medicare and Medicaid), Tricare and private payer policies that directly impact provider billing. Plays a critical role in researching, analyzing and conveying federal, state, and private policies that impacts Medicare, Medicaid, and commercial coverage, compliance and billing, along with becoming an expert on key issues related to changes in health care policy, including but not limited to health care reform.
Responsibilities:
Responsible and accountable for reviewing all relevant payer policy alerts (e.g. bulletins) and/or Notices of Proposed Rule Making and Final Rules.
Analyze payer policy changes to identify potential operational, billing, coding, or reimbursement impacts.
Support assessment of financial risk or opportunity associated with policy changes, including identification of policies that may result in underpayments or denials.
Escalate complex or high risk policy issues to senior analysts or leadership for deeper financial analysis.
Prepare clear, concise summaries of payer policies and their implications for non technical audiences.
Assist with development of standardized workflows and documentation related to payer policy analytics.
Support the driving of all necessary changes as a result of payer updates to reimbursement policies. Works collaboratively across the HCS to ensure that information and tasks are disseminated appropriately and timely.
Support the Policy Analytics team via recurring interdepartmental meetings to review policy updates and confirm ownership of follow up actions with relevant stakeholders.
Responsible for program and project assignments working independently or collaboratively as appropriate to accomplish the assigned work. Identify issues and assist in developing strategies to address them prior to issues becoming critical. Keep Policy Analytics team informed of project(s) status and any potential concerns.
